Prior to 1982, a penny made entirely of copper was significantly heavier than the zinc and copper alloy counterparts.

Read on as we cover the origins and transformations of the penny, and why understanding its journey is crucial for anyone interested in the heritage and future of u.s The penny was one of the first coins made by the u.s Mint after its establishment in 1792 The design on the first penny was of a woman with flowing hair symbolizing liberty
